BOCHUM BLASTED
HEAVY R.A.F. NIGHT ATTACK ON RUHR COAL & IRON CENTRE. OTHER TARGETS BOMBED AND MINES LAID. If LONDON, September 30. The K.A.F. again attacked Germany last night. The main target was Bochum, 10 miles east of Essen, the central Ruhr. It is an important coal-mining centre and has iron and steel industries. The attack was officially described as heavy. More mines were laid to menace enemy shipping. The night’s losses were eight bombers.
